单项选择题

下述函数功能是_______。
int fun(char*x)
char*y=x;
while(*y++);
return y-s-1;

A.求字符串的长度
B.求字符串存放的位置
C.比较两个字符串的大小
D.将字符串x连接到字符串y后面
<上一题 目录 下一题>
热门 试题

填空题
下述函数统计一个字符串中的单词个数,单词是指处在空格之间的字符序列,请填空。 int word(char*s) int num=0, flag=0; while(*s) if( 【18】 ==’’) flag=0; else if( 【19】 )flag=1;num++ return 【20】 ;
单项选择题
下面是对宏定义的描述,不正确的是()。

A.宏不存在类型问题,宏名无类型,它的参数也无类型
B.宏替换不占用运行时间
C.宏替换时先求出实参表达式的值,然后代入形参运算求值
D.宏替换只不过是字符替代而已

相关试题
  • 以下函数的功能是计算s=1+1 2!+1...
  • 函数delete(s,i,n)是作用是从字符串s中...
  • 下述函数统计一个字符串中的单词个数,单词...
  • 下面程序的运行结果是 【15】 。 main...
  • 下面程序有两个printf语句,如果第一个prin...